1. How long does the black skirt fish live

The black skirt fish is a kind of ornamental fish.The life span of black skirt fish is generally between 6 and 7 years.However, this is in a very suitable environment.If the surrounding environment is not conducive to their growth, then it will affect their life span.For black skirt fish raised in families, their life span is generally shorter because they are more sensitive to the surrounding environment.Some black skirt fish will die in about three years.Even some new breeders of black skirt fish will have a shorter life span, because they may die of illness.

If you want to make their life longer, you need to pay attention to the way of breeding, water temperature, water quality and feeding.In addition, in the process of breeding, we need to pay attention to the problem of reproduction.It can be propagated in about 8-10 months.You can breed them, you can breed them all the time.

2. how big can the black skirt fish grow

The size of the black skirt fish is not too big, and it belongs to a relatively small ornamental fish.How big they can grow depends on many factors.If the wild species, then their size will be relatively large, adult after their length will be between 6-8 cm; However, if the black skirt fish is raised in the family, their body size is generally small, and their body length is generally between 3-6 centimeters after adulthood.How long it can grow is also related to the proper way of farming.If the surrounding water environment is suitable and they are provided with adequate food, they will be in a good state of development and will be relatively large.On the contrary, there will be dysplasia, and the body size will be shorter.
